Knowing your hair need's is a must when it comes to selecting and utilizing new beauty products. All hair types may benefit from the conditioner, but not all hair types have the same needs. To avoid saturation, use the following guide (do not apply on scalp, unless you have a low dry scalp):
Short Hair: Use a pea-sized amount. Emulsify in the hands first. Apply mainly to mid-lengths and ends. Avoid the scalp unless hair is chemically damaged. Leave on for 3–5 minutes.
- Why: Short hair has less surface area and less cumulative damage, so excessive product may coat the fiber unnecessarily. A small amount provides conditioning without flattening the hair’s natural volume or movement.
Fine Hair: Use a small amount (dime-sized). Apply strictly to mid-lengths and ends. Comb through with a wide-tooth comb to distribute evenly. Leave for 3–4 minutes.
- Why: Fine hair fibers have smaller diameters and lower structural mass, making them more prone to being weighed down by conditioning lipids and silicones. Controlled application maintains hydration and repair while preserving natural body and lift.
Medium Hair: Use a quarter-sized amount. Distribute evenly from mid-lengths to ends. Leave on for 5 minutes before rinsing.
- Why: Medium-density hair benefits from the mask’s balanced system of proteins, humectants, and lipids, which helps restore elasticity and improve surface smoothness without excessive heaviness.
Normal Hair: Apply moderate amount from mid-lengths to ends. Comb through to ensure even distribution. Leave for 5–7 minutes.
- Why: Normal hair typically requires maintenance conditioning rather than intensive reconstruction, so even distribution ensures the fiber receives balanced hydration and strengthening without overloading the structure.
Long Hair/Extra Long Hair: Divide hair into two or four sections. Apply mask from mid-lengths downward, concentrating heavily on the ends. Leave for 7–10 minutes.
- Why: Long hair experiences greater cumulative damage due to friction, environmental exposure, and repeated styling. The ends are typically more porous and require additional lipid and protein support to restore softness and prevent breakage.
Abundant (thick) Hair: Work in sections to ensure even saturation. Apply generously from mid-lengths to ends. Detangle with a wide-tooth comb. Leave for 8–10 minutes.
- Why: Thick hair has higher fiber density and larger cross-sectional area, meaning more product is needed to adequately coat and condition each strand. Sectioning ensures uniform penetration and optimal conditioning.

- Multi-Protein Repair System: A targeted blend of hydrolyzed keratin, soy protein, and silk amino acids helps reinforce weakened hair fibers and smooth the cuticle surface. This multi-protein complex temporarily fortifies compromised areas of the hair shaft, improving resilience, softness, and overall structural integrity after daily stress or chemical processing.
- Intensive Moisture Replenisher: Glycerin and panthenol work together to help attract and retain moisture within the hair fiber, supporting improved elasticity and flexibility. This hydration-focused system restores softness and helps reduce dryness, leaving hair smoother, more supple, and easier to manage.
- Anti-Breakage Support: Professional conditioning agents help reduce friction between hair strands, improving combability and minimizing mechanical stress during brushing and styling. By enhancing fiber lubrication and flexibility, the formula helps protect against breakage and promotes healthier-looking hair over time.
- Chemical-Recovery Treatment: The acid-balanced formula helps compact the cuticle layer and rebalance the hair fiber after chemical services such as bleaching, coloring, or highlighting. Conditioning lipids and strengthening proteins help restore manageability, shine, and surface smoothness to sensitized hair.
